9 Things That Should Never Go Down the Drain

How often do you think about what you’re putting down your drains? If you mindlessly flush items down your drains, you’re not alone. Most people don’t think about potential drain damage until there’s a blockage. However, when it comes to your plumbing system’s health, you need to watch what you flush down your drains. Putting anything down your drain besides water, human waste, and toilet paper can create significant damage that requires costly repairs.

9 Things You Should Never Put Down Your Drains

 

If you want to avoid plumbing clogs, you should never put the following items down your drains:

 

1.   Eggshells

 

While it might seem like eggshells can easily travel down your drains without causing a clog, they can quickly backup your plumbing system. The rough, hard edges of the shell can combine with additional debris and eventually clog your drain.

 

2. Coffee Grounds

 

One of the worst culprits for clogging drains, according to plumbers, is coffee grounds. Most people think that coffee grounds are too tiny to get stuck in their plumbing pipes, but they can create significant blockages. To avoid this problem, make sure you dispose of grinds in the garbage before rinsing and cleaning mugs.

 

3. Grease

 

Garbage disposals efficiently grind up food particles to dispose of them without blocking your drains. Still, oil, grease, and other fats do not break down in your garbage disposal. Since these substances can solidify and easily block your plumbing pipes, you should never pour them down the drain.

 

4. Stickers

 

Small plastic stickers, such as those seen on fruit and vegetable, can easily get washed down your drain. However, they can adhere to the sides of your pipe and create significant blockages.

 

5. Cotton Balls and Paper Towels

 

Paper towels and cotton balls are biodegradable, but they don’t break up easily. Since they absorb water, they’re can quickly clog your drains. That’s why you should never throw these items down your drain.

 

6. Flour

 

When flour combines with water, it forms a coagulant that can build up and block your pipes.  Other debris also combines with flour on its way down the drain and creates a significant blockage. This is why you should never flush flour down your drains.

 

7. Medication

 

Medications shouldn’t be flushed down your drains not only because they can block them but because they can leak chemicals back into your drinking water. You should always dispose of unused medications at your local drugstore or prescription medication drop instead of flushing them down your drains.

 

8. Baby Wipes

 

Although most people think that wet wipes are just like toilet paper, they are actually not flushable. Since they can easily block your plumbing system, you should throw them in the garbage can rather than down your drains.

 

9. Paint

 

Paint can also easily clog your drains. Not only should you avoid putting paint down your drain pipes to avoid clogs, but many types of paint also include hazardous compounds that you don’t want in your water supply.
